Oracle數據庫遷移指南:快速move數據的技巧
在當今數據驅動的世界中,數據庫的遷移成為企業運營中不可或缺的一部分。Oracle數據庫作為一個強大的數據管理系統,經常需要進行遷移以適應業務需求的變化。本文將探討Oracle數據庫的遷移過程,並提供一些快速移動數據的技巧。
遷移的準備工作
在開始遷移之前,進行充分的準備是至關重要的。以下是一些關鍵步驟:
- 評估當前環境:了解現有數據庫的結構、大小和性能需求。
- 選擇遷移方法:根據需求選擇合適的遷移方法,如數據泵(Data Pump)、資料庫鏈接(Database Link)或使用Oracle GoldenGate。
- 備份數據:在進行任何遷移之前,務必備份所有數據,以防止數據丟失。
Oracle數據庫的遷移方法
Oracle提供了多種數據庫遷移的方法,以下是幾種常見的選擇:
1. 使用數據泵(Data Pump)
數據泵是一種高效的數據導出和導入工具,適合大規模數據遷移。使用數據泵的基本步驟如下:
-- 導出數據
expdp username/password DIRECTORY=dir_name DUMPFILE=dumpfile.dmp LOGFILE=export.log
-- 導入數據
impdp username/password DIRECTORY=dir_name DUMPFILE=dumpfile.dmp LOGFILE=import.log2. 使用資料庫鏈接(Database Link)
資料庫鏈接允許在不同的Oracle數據庫之間直接進行數據傳輸。這種方法適合需要實時數據遷移的情況。
INSERT INTO target_table@remote_db
SELECT * FROM source_table;3. 使用Oracle GoldenGate
Oracle GoldenGate是一個實時數據複製和遷移解決方案,適合需要高可用性和最小停機時間的環境。它支持多種數據庫平台之間的數據遷移。
遷移後的驗證
數據遷移完成後,進行驗證是非常重要的。以下是一些驗證步驟:
- 檢查數據完整性:確保所有數據都已正確遷移,並且沒有丟失或損壞。
- 性能測試:測試新環境的性能,確保其滿足業務需求。
- 應用測試:確保所有應用程序能夠正常連接並使用新的數據庫。
結論
Oracle數據庫的遷移是一個複雜但必要的過程。通過充分的準備、選擇合適的遷移方法以及進行後續驗證,可以確保數據的安全和完整性。無論是使用數據泵、資料庫鏈接還是Oracle GoldenGate,選擇最適合您需求的方法將有助於提高遷移的效率和成功率。
如果您正在尋找可靠的 香港VPS 解決方案來支持您的Oracle數據庫遷移,Server.HK提供多種選擇,幫助您輕鬆管理數據庫環境。